Events Assistant - London Wildlife Trust

We’re looking for an Events Assistant to help achieve our vision of London alive with nature, where everyone can experience and enjoy wildlife. Our Events team is small but mighty – made up of our Head of Events who you’ll report into, and our Events Planner who you’ll work closely with, you’ll play a key role in developing London Wildlife Trust’s events.

Role & Responsibilities

You’ll be the main point of contact for the team both internally and externally, providing sales and operational support. You can expect to:

  • Manage enquiries both via email, telephone and in person
  • Conduct site visits with potential clients and provide follow up information
  • Build a warm and friendly rapport with clients, guiding them throughout their journey with us
  • Liaise with suppliers, conduct logistics meetings and prepare event schedules
  • Plan and deliver events
  • Monitor and upload social media content

What’s in it for you?

Salary: £23,168 per annum

Tenure: Permanent, full time contract

25 days annual leave pro rata plus statutory holidays

Pension scheme

Access to a free Employee Assistance Scheme to support you inside and outside of work

Supportive and inclusive policies including a family-friendly policy and enhanced flexible working policy

‘Staff Day’ once a quarter where you can get involved in conservation work on one of our sites

Job requirements

  • Our ideal Events Assistant
  • Experience of onsite event delivery in the wedding or corporate sector
  • Proven administration skills
  • Ability to manage multiple projects simultaneously
  • Strong customer service experience
